Sanghadasa Berugoda
Sanghadasa Berugoda (c. 1934 – 2007) was the 38th Surveyor General of Sri Lanka. He was appointed in 1992, succeeding Thamotharam Somasekaram, and held the office until 1993. He was succeeded by N. C. Seneviratne.[1]

Berugoda died in Adelaide, Australia in 2007 at the age of 73.[2]
